Fee Analysis
| Fee Type | This Provider | Industry Average | Verdict |
|---|---|---|---|
| Monthly Maintenance* | $4.00 | $0.69 | ABOVE AVG |
| Account Opening | $0.00 | $1.88 | EXCELLENT |
| Account Closing | $25.00 | $1.95 | ABOVE AVG |
| Check Printing | $0.00 | N/A | -- |
| Wire transfer (Domestic outgoing and HSA transfers | $25.00 | N/A | -- |
* $4/month - Waived if balance > $2,500
Industry averages calculated from 853 providers in the HSA Orbit database.

Interest Rates
Standard Rates
| Balance Range | APY |
|---|---|
| $0 - $2,500 | 0.10% |
| $2,500 - $10,000 | 0.30% |
| $10,000 - $25,000 | 0.30% |
| $25,000+ | 0.50% |
Last updated: 04-22-2025
